Transaction 789738fb7fc4c8e7e23c183337f886d666210c36fa49aefca5ec3d390bb072db
1 Input
1 Output
-
789738fb7fc4c8e7e23c183337f886d666210c36fa49aefca5ec3d390bb072db:0
- value
- 240120434
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8830d127dee8a1526fcb73b412d4702536879c7
- address
- bc1qezps6ynaa69p2fhukua5zt28qffks7w8hd56hf